当前位置: 首页 > 产品大全 > 计算机网络 从体系结构到技术开发与服务

计算机网络 从体系结构到技术开发与服务

计算机网络 从体系结构到技术开发与服务

计算机网络是现代信息社会的基石,它通过通信链路和网络设备,将分布在不同地理位置的计算机系统连接起来,实现资源共享和信息交换。本文将从计算机网络的基本概述出发,深入探讨其核心的体系结构,并展望其技术开发与服务的未来趋势。

一、 计算机网络概述

计算机网络的核心目标是实现“互联”与“共享”。它由硬件(如计算机、路由器、交换机、网线、光纤)和软件(如网络协议、操作系统、应用程序)共同构成。根据地理覆盖范围,网络可分为局域网(LAN)、城域网(MAN)和广域网(WAN);互联网(Internet)则是全球最大的广域网。计算机网络的发展,从早期的ARPANET到今天的万物互联(IoT),彻底改变了人类的工作、学习与生活方式,成为驱动数字经济发展的关键基础设施。

二、 计算机网络体系结构

为了简化网络设计的复杂性,并确保不同厂商设备间的互操作性,计算机网络采用了分层化的体系结构。其中最经典和广泛采用的是OSI(开放系统互连)七层参考模型TCP/IP四层模型

  1. OSI七层模型(理论标准):从下至上依次为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。每一层都承担特定功能,并为上层提供服务,层与层之间通过接口进行通信。这种分层思想使得协议设计、故障排查和网络升级变得模块化且高效。
  2. TCP/IP模型(事实标准):由网络接口层(对应OSI的物理层和数据链路层)、网际层(对应网络层,核心协议是IP)、传输层(核心协议是TCP和UDP)和应用层(对应OSI的上三层)构成。它是当今互联网运行的基石协议簇。

体系结构中的关键概念包括协议(通信双方必须遵守的规则)、服务(下层为上层提供的功能)以及封装与解封装(数据在发送时自上而下添加头部信息,接收时自下而上剥离头部信息的过程)。理解体系结构是掌握网络通信原理的关键。

三、 计算机网络技术开发及服务

在清晰的体系结构指导下,计算机网络技术不断演进,催生了丰富的开发领域和服务模式。

  1. 核心技术开发方向
  • 高速与高性能网络:如5G/6G移动通信、400G/800G以太网、光网络技术的突破,追求更高的带宽和更低的延迟。
  • 软件定义网络(SDN)与网络功能虚拟化(NFV):将网络控制面与数据面分离,通过软件编程方式灵活配置网络,提升了网络管理的智能化和敏捷性。
  • 网络安全技术:包括防火墙、入侵检测/防御系统(IDS/IPS)、加密技术(如SSL/TLS)、零信任架构等,以应对日益严峻的网络威胁。
  • 物联网(IoT)与边缘计算:将网络延伸到物理世界,并在数据源附近进行处理,满足实时性要求高的应用场景。
  • 新一代网络协议:如IPv6的全面部署,以解决IPv4地址枯竭问题,并带来更好的安全性和效率。
  1. 主要网络服务模式
  • 基础设施即服务(IaaS):提供虚拟化的计算、存储和网络资源(如AWS EC2,阿里云ECS)。
  • 平台即服务(PaaS):提供应用程序开发、部署和运行的平台环境(如Google App Engine,腾讯云开发平台)。
  • 软件即服务(SaaS):通过互联网提供软件应用(如Office 365, Salesforce,各类在线协作工具)。
  • 内容分发网络(CDN)服务:将内容缓存到全球边缘节点,极大提升用户访问网站、视频的速度和体验。
  • 云网融合服务:将云计算与广域网络深度集成,为企业提供一站式、高质量的上云和互联服务。

计算机网络是一个庞大而充满活力的领域。从分层的体系结构这一理论基础出发,到日新月异的技术开发实践,最终落地为形形色色的网络服务,三者环环相扣,共同推动着信息时代的车轮滚滚向前。随着人工智能、量子通信等技术的融入,计算机网络必将朝着更智能、更安全、更无处不在的方向持续进化,为社会创造更大的价值。

更新时间:2026-01-13 01:38:52

如若转载,请注明出处:http://www.lyc22.com/product/55.html